Output 661bbc16dfd286abb1700cab9235f995ccc8bbe6030ce4bc592e25405a1f50dc:1

value
24849048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880a12677dfea39959c34ec4966fc0eaef1e44ef OP_EQUAL
address
3E6KtSUPRHsUjgSRKQPHYJoKwRM5Lys5Vp
transaction
661bbc16dfd286abb1700cab9235f995ccc8bbe6030ce4bc592e25405a1f50dc
spent
true